私はビデオを( でVideoView
)縦向きモード(全画面ではない)で再生していて、
横向きモードにするとビデオが停止します。
横向きに変更すると、ビデオは全画面で表示され、再生され続けます。
なにか提案を?
ベストアンサー1
AndroidManifest.xml のアクティビティにこれを追加するだけです:
android:configChanges="orientation"
ビデオアクティビティは次のようになります。
<activity android:name=".VideoPlayerActivity"
android:configChanges="orientation" />
によるとこの答え:
ターゲットAPIレベルが13以上の場合は、説明されている値
screenSize
に加えて値を含める必要があります。orientation
ここビデオアクティビティは次のようになります。<activity android:name=".VideoPlayerActivity" android:configChanges="orientation|screenSize" />
次に、VideoPlayerActivity に次のメソッドを追加します。
@Override
public void onConfigurationChanged(Configuration newConfig) {
super.onConfigurationChanged(newConfig);
}